A263261 Row 1 of A263255. 2
1, 9, 10, 25, 26, 28, 38, 49, 52, 66, 68, 74, 76, 80, 82, 110, 112, 122, 124, 126, 127, 131, 133, 156, 168, 169, 170, 172, 176, 178, 180, 188, 218, 226, 234, 238, 258, 278, 288, 290, 300, 304, 306, 316, 318, 322, 334, 361, 362, 368, 398, 414, 422, 448, 452, 470, 478, 496, 514, 518, 526, 586 (list; graph; refs; listen; history; text; internal format)
OFFSET
1,2
COMMENTS
Numbers n for which A263254(n) = 1. Numbers that are one edge removed from the infinite trunk (A259934) of the tree defined by edge-relation A049820(child) = parent.
